Red Dot Museum showcases ideas and products with a
contemporary design. Admission is free on the first weekend of the month, where
there will also be Artist’ Market. The market attracts local and foreign
visitors, where many creative products are sold.
MSC students went to the museum last Friday, and took in
many ideas and concepts from the designers that ‘WOW-ed’ everyone. Many
students commented on the creative ways to display their product, where it
looked exceptionally stunning yet cost effective. Handmade products were
conscientiously made with every single intricate detail. Some interesting food
products was the ice-cream, any size any amount. The students crowded the stall
as they could pay at any amount for the exciting flavors offered. Another stall
sold sugar coated lollipop which had a mini cupcake hidden inside.
